comment effectuer une itération sur un curseur

J'ai une instruction select qui retourne une seule ligne.
Après que j'ai écrit un curseur que pour moi @@fetch_status est de -1 il ne veut pas aller à l'intérieur du curseur seulement maintenant

open cur_mkt    
print @init 
While (@init = 0)      
Begin      
fetch next from cur_mkt into       
@Desc,      
@Divisions      
print @@fetch_status
if (@@fetch_status =-1)      
BREAK   

Est il possible que je puisse aller à l'intérieur du curseur,
merci de m'aider.

InformationsquelleAutor happysmile | 2011-01-25